This unit expands the children’s independent writing to include both a piece of fiction and a piece of non-fiction writing. They learn explicitly about using conjunctions to join simple sentences, as well as avoiding run-on sentences.

Core texts are Lost and Found by Oliver Jeffers, Antarctica: A Continent of Wonder by Mario Cuesta Hernando and Where on Earth? Antarctica by Shalini Vallepur.

Included:

  • Lesson plans for unit (18 tasks: 4 - 6 weeks)

  • 63 PowerPoint slides to support lessons

  • Resources to support lessons

  • List of suggested texts to support and enrich learning
